Default Reactor Finished

Update,

I tested my tank today and my calcium is up to 420 and Alk 10.6 I'm so happy, I was fighting to keep a calcium of 350-370 with the Kent Tech CB 2 part system, dosing 2 times per day for 2 months. Too much work!!! The reactor has been online for 3 weeks now.

I do have 1 problem. I get a great change in flow rate through the reactor some times. I don't know if the needle valve is pluging with debris or what. I did have to remove the check valve / quick connect I had installed in the line from my pump to the reactor.

I have T'd into the line that goes to my ETSS skimmer and use this pressure to give the flow through the reactor. I have noticed that the foam level has a very minor change in the flow on the flowmeter. Any thing I'm missing? I think I will try a dedicated powerhead and see what happens. What does everyone else use??

Also now that I have the system up I will put the media into the second chamber.
